The Siemens NX 7.5 (formerly Unigraphics) was a landmark release in the evolution of high-end CAD/CAM/CAE software

. While it remains powerful for legacy workflows, downloading it via torrents presents significant legal and security risks, especially when legitimate alternatives exist. www.viewmold.com NX 7.5 Capability Review Originally released in

, NX 7.5 introduced several "best-in-class" features that set the standard for modern engineering software: Large Assembly Performance:

One of the most significant updates was the ability to load, view, and measure massive assemblies (thousands of parts) without loading the full "heavy" data description, greatly improving hardware efficiency. Synchronous Technology:

This version refined the direct modeling environment, allowing users to grab and manipulate geometry without the limitations of a history tree. Integrated CAE:

NX 7.5 significantly expanded simulation capabilities, introducing tools for flexible body dynamics, durability analysis, and multi-physics solvers within the same environment as design. Progressive Die Design:

It featured advanced automation for tool and die makers, capable of reducing tool design time by up to 60-70% through standard part libraries and strip simulation. Risks of Torrenting NX 7.5 "Unigraphics NX 7

While the desire to access this legacy tool is understandable, the path of illegal downloads is fraught with technical, legal, and security pitfalls. The Evolution of Unigraphics NX 7.5

Released by Siemens PLM Software, NX 7.5 introduced the revolutionary Synchronous Technology 3. This allowed engineers to edit geometry regardless of how the model was originally built, bridging the gap between history-based and history-free modeling. For many firms, NX 7.5 became the "gold standard" for:

Complex Surface Modeling: Essential for automotive and aerospace industries.

Advanced Simulation: Integrating stress and thermal analysis directly into the design workflow.

Tool and Die Design: Automating the creation of molds and fixtures. Why People Still Search for NX 7.5 Torrents
